Peab acquires the Construction and Civil Engineering of Midroc

Peab has acquired Midroc Construction AB and their subsidiary Midroc Construction in Gothenburg AB. Peab hereby takes over the construction- and civil engineering activities of Midroc Construction, including all staff, ongoing contracts and the order backlog. Midroc Construction operates in the south of Sweden with the Gothenburg and Jönköping areas as the northern border. The company has around 500 employees and the turnover in 2004 amounted to SEK 900 million, of which SEK 150 million within civil engineering. The take over will be made when the Swedish Competition Authority have completed their examination, which is estimated to be in the beginning of 2006. Accepted negotiations concerning rights of participation in decision-making have been carried out. - The acquisition of Midroc Construction means that Peab further strengthens the construction- and civil engineering activities in the southern and western parts of Sweden, says Peab’s MD Mats Paulsson. - The dispose of Midroc Construction means that we can focus on and develop our other activities within the real estate sector, such as real estate development and construction management, says Roger Wikström, Midroc.
